Story
Sunshine, a male orange tabby was born around April 2020. He was found by a resident and turned into the Rescue. He occasionally talks at meal times. Sunny hasn’t met dogs or kids under age eight. With proper introductions he gets along with most cats and he’d enjoy another cat for a pal. The foster mom says he is sweet, smart, friendly with known people, and affectionate on his terms. Sunny is shy/avoidant of strangers. At this stage, he is uncomfortable being picked up. Sunny likes playing with interactive wand toys and watching birds at the window. He has fine litterbox habits and uses a scratching post. Are you the patient person willing to give him time to trust and blossom in a new setting and you be rewarded with a special relationship with him? Story
Stormy is an easy-going, confident, orange tabby male with white undersides and socks, who was born in March 2025. He gets along with the foster’s active dog and both male and female cats. Stormy is friendly with strangers. He face rubs, head butts, and ankle rubs. He is quiet, gives kitty kisses, and is kitten-active. Stormy is okay being picked up and carried. When you sit, he jumps into your lap or lets you place him there. Stormy stays for short periods of brushing or petting. Then he is off to play with cat toys or watch wildlife out the window. He follows you around the house wanting to sit near you. Stormy hasn’t met children, but if they are gentle and respectful he should do fine. He enjoys playing with interactive wand toys, also. He was found with an injured leg and was unclaimed. He uses a scratching post and has fine litterbox habits. This cat and others are available at Cat Tales Rescue. Story
Meet Tiger! 🐯Tiger has a calm, gentle personality and enjoys spending time outdoors.Tiger is a sweet boy who is still learning to trust people. He can be a little shy and flinch if approached too quickly, but he is not aggressive. He simply needs someone who will let him settle in at his own pace and earn his trust.Tiger is litter trained but has not yet been seen by a veterinarian and is not neutered. He appears healthy overall, but he occasionally makes a wheezy or coughing sound, so his new family should plan to have him examined by a veterinarian.Tiger would thrive in a calm, loving home with someone who understands that building trust takes time. If you’re looking for a quiet gentle companion, Tiger may be the perfect match.

Story
We adopted Kitty from Facebook marketplace around six years ago. She came from a family that had lots of dogs. When we adopted her, she was sick and had stones so we had surgery done to remove them. Because of that issue, Kitty is on a special prescription food. It just helps her to prevent getting stones again. Kitty is very loyal to her family and loves to be in the same room as you at all times. She is very good with kids however she is not the cuddly type. She loves to play with all of her toys, her light laser and chase things around the house. She doesn’t however, like to sit on your lap she’s a private territorial is her personality so she would be best in a home without other animals. The ideal adopter for Kitty would be an older adult or perhaps a child that has patience and would not demand too much attention. She is litter box trained, however, needs a higher sided box. Kitty is very healthy and is approximately eight years old. My daughter moved so need to rehome her.
